Letters Patent of Nobility for Diego Sanz.

Valladolid, Spain, 18 June 1569.

Folio format manuscript on parchment, consisting of 37 leaves sewn as a single signature, with large illuminated page featuring a coat of arms, IHS emblem surrounded by roses and lady beetles on a gilt field; the text in a rounded notary hand; concerning the case of Diego Sanz of Lardero under the ruling of the Spanish government in King Philip II's reign; Sanz sued to recover his title of nobility, and this document records the court proceedings, ending with the reinstatement of his status as hidalgo; lacking the original seal, with a later synopsis manuscript on paper loosely inserted, sewing perished, detached from original limp parchment covering, 12 3/4 x 9 in.
